driven by earl reiback arts-ejp 53 arrow o n the right the cars met at the intersection in front of taylor gym all rotc students will be giv en an opportunity to sign a new deferment agreement as a condi tion to a continued defeiment in view of a new development in the government's attitude toward rotc cadets maj james harkins associate professor ms&t an nounced wednesday the enactment of the universal military training and service act amends the selective service act in that it stipulates that persons entering the armed forces prior to their 26th birthday shall be re quired to serve in the armed for ces for a period of eight years the amendment further stipulates that rotc students selected for deferment will agree in writing to accept a commission if tendered and to serve not less than two years on active duty and re main a member of the regular or reserve component of the army for six years persons previously were re quired to serve not less than two years on active duty and remain a member of the regular or re serve component only three years accordingly a memorandum see rotc page 6 accident rise causes major problem at lu two more automobile accidents involving lehigh woolf blackburn to be shown at library an exhibit of drawings and paintings by s j woolf and mor ris blackburn featuring 49 por traits of famous men and women will open at 2 p.m sunday in the lehigh art gallery where the show will continue until jan 8 notable persons such as irving berlin omar bradley lionel bar rymore walt disney henry ford al jolson helen keller lily pons roy rogers bill robinson h g wells and wendell willkie are among the drawings done by woolf woolf who has exhibited at many noted clubs and in stitutions was a correspon dent with the a.e.f during world war i at which time he painted a series of por traits of leading american generals he served as a war correspondent in england and france for nea during world war 11 morris blackburn whose prints are
